boxplot在matlab中的用法
合集下载
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
boxplot在matlab中的用法
在MATLAB中,可以使用boxplot函数来创建箱线图。
boxplot函数的基本用法如下:
boxplot(X): 创建一组箱线图,其中X是一个向量或矩阵,每列对应于一个箱线图。
boxplot(X, G): 创建多组箱线图,其中X是一个向量或矩阵,G是一个与X大小相同的向量或矩阵,用于指定每个数据点所属的组。
boxplot(X, Name, Value): 创建箱线图,并指定其他参数。
常见的参数包括'Labels'(指定组的标签)、'Colors'(指定组的颜色)和'Whisker'(指定箱线图的须线类型)。
例如,以下代码创建一个箱线图,其中X是一个向量,表示一组数据:
matlab
X = [1 2 3 4 5 6 7 8 9 10];
boxplot(X);
以下代码创建多组箱线图,其中X是一个矩阵,每列对应于一组数据,G是一个与X大小相同的矩阵,用于指定每个数据点所属的组:
matlab
X = [1 2 3 4 5 6 7 8 9 10;
2 4 6 8 10 12 14 16 18 20];
G = [1 1 1 1 1 2 2 2 2 2];
boxplot(X, G);
可以通过设置其他参数来进一步自定义箱线图的外观,例如:
matlab
boxplot(X, 'Labels', {'Group A', 'Group B'}, 'Colors', {'r', 'b'}, 'Whisker', 1.5);
这将创建一个有标签的箱线图,每个组的颜色分别为红色和蓝色,须线类型为1.5倍的箱线长度。